Dr. Gerber is a holistic family chiropractor. She founded her practice within the Centenary Health Centre of RVHS in 1997 and has served the hospital community, Scarborough and Greater Toronto with a passion for health every day since. Dr. Gerber is a certified Active Release Techniques (ART ®) provider. She employs soft tissue therapy, anti-inflammatory modalities, laser treatment , electro-current therapy, mobilization and full body adjustments. This multi-faceted approach helps to maximize her patients’ response to treatment, and can reduce time for healing. She uses technically advanced computerized gait analysis, in combination with postural assessment and measurements to provide custom made orthotics.
